How Commercial Water Removal Works
With Commercial Water Removal,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ition as quickly and efficiently as possible. From the initial assessment to the final clean-up, we’ll guide you through every step of the way.
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of your property to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, assess the damage, and provide a detailed estimate for the work to be done. Our technicians are trained to spot hidden damage and provide a comprehensive plan to restore your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using state-of-the-art equipment, our team will extract as much water as possible from your property. We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. Our equipment is designed to reduce downtime and get your business back up and running quickly.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will focus on drying and dehumidifying your property.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. Our team will work tirelessly to ensure that your property is completely dry and free of mo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, our team will cl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ining moisture, dirt, and debris.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products and techniques to ensure that your property is safe and healthy for occupants. Our team is committed to delivering a clean and healthy environment for your business.

Commercial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in a single room | Yes | No | You can handle small leaks with DIY methods and save money.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| A burst pipe can cause extensive damage and needs professional equ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Water damage from a natural disaster | No | Yes | Natural disasters can cause extensive damage and need professional equ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Water damage in a large commercial space | No | Yes | Large commercial spaces need specialized equipment and expertise to fix water damage. |
| Water damage with hidden structural damage | No | Yes | Hidden structural damage needs professional expertise to detect and fix. |
| Water damage with sensitive electronics or equipment | No | Yes | Sensitive electronics or equipment need specialized care and expertise to fix water damage. |

Commercial Water Removal Cost In Tukwila, WA
The cost of Commercial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Tukwila,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of Commercial Water Remov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products used. |
| Structural repairs |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the structural damage and the materials required to fix it. |
| Equipment rental | $500 – $2,000 | The type and quantity of equipment required to fix the water damage. |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the inspection and assessment process.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available.
